The Sun God has two palms, lies on lotus pedestal; both hands are embellished with lotus flowers. There’s a stunning, golden crown around on his head and his waist a garland of jewels. His radiance is much like the inner portion of a lotus flower and he’s supported by seven horses on the chariot pulled.
The seven colours emanating from the Sun are the VIBGYOR, which is symbolically represented as the chariot ‘s seven riders.
In his chariot there is only one wheel called ‘Samvatsar.’ His chariot wheel has twelve spokes, which symbolise the twelve months. The wheel has six circumferences symbolising the six seasons, and three ‘Naves’ symbolising the three months.

Surya is Simha Rasi’s Lord and is at the middle of the navagrahas. The adidevatha is Agni, Devatha prathyutha — Rudran. His colour is red, and his vahana is a seven-horse drawn chariot. His grain is maize; the herb-lotus, yerukku; silk-red clothes; diamond-ruby; fruit-barley, rava, pongal chakkara.
